Transaction ecfa781ed2ba3806938789d91fdd178d1df9073ab0a91dbaadffce6af540a10e
1 Input
1 Output
-
ecfa781ed2ba3806938789d91fdd178d1df9073ab0a91dbaadffce6af540a10e:0
- value
- 150648
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 a380907c2db7ede70776be03e29b2f61c6fa3a5ff485a2138c0bc61bacf206d4
- address
- bc1p5wqfqlpdklk7wpmkhcp79xe0v8r05wjl7jz6yyuvp0rpht8jqm2qe76uhx